What You’ll Be Doing

You won’t just be assisting—you’ll serve as a licensed professional delivering advanced, high-quality patient care:

  • Communicate medical information clearly and compassionately to pet owners, ensuring full understanding of diagnoses, treatment plans, and at-home care instructions
  • Accurately implement and oversee prescribed treatments, including medication calculations, administration, therapies, and follow-up care
  • Perform and support advanced diagnostic procedures such as radiography, laboratory analysis, cytology, and sample collection
  • Induce, monitor, and recover patients under anesthesia, including continuous assessment of vital parameters and anesthetic depth
  • Place IV catheters, perform venipuncture, and administer fluids, injections, and blood products as indicated
  • Conduct patient assessments, triage cases, and promptly identify and communicate changes in patient status
  • Maintain complete, accurate, and legally compliant electronic medical records and treatment logs
  • Ensure adherence to hospital protocols, safety standards, and state licensing regulations
  • Support efficient clinic operations, including appointment coordination, inpatient care, and emergency response readiness
  • Mentor and provide guidance to veterinary assistants and support staff as appropriate
  • Collaborate closely with DVMs and the veterinary team to develop and execute comprehensive patient care plans
  • Contribute to a positive, professional work environment focused on high-quality medicine and client service
 

Your Skill Set (Tech + People Skills)

We’re looking for someone who’s not just certified—but confident in their technical abilities:

Proficient in:

  • Venipuncture & catheter placement
  • Lab diagnostics (bloodwork, urinalysis, cytology basics)
  • Digital radiology + imaging support
  • Anesthesia monitoring equipment (pulse ox, capnography, ECG)
  • Comfortable using veterinary software
  • Strong understanding of animal handling, restraint techniques, and patient safety
  • Ability to multitask in a fast-paced clinical environment without sacrificing accuracy
  • Clear communicator—able to translate “vet speak” into real-world language for clients
  • Team-first mindset with a positive, professional vibe

Qualifications

  • Graduate of an accredited Veterinary Technician program (Associate Degree)
  • Passed the VTNE + active/eligible RVT license
  • Previous experience in a veterinary setting preferred
  • Passion for patient care and client education (non-negotiable )
